Understanding the Importance of Website Security

In an era where data breaches and cyberattacks are increasingly common, a secure website is crucial for several reasons:

Protecting User Data: Websites often collect sensitive user information, such as personal details, login credentials, and financial data. Robust security measures protect this data from falling into the wrong hands.
Maintaining Trust & Reputation: A security breach can severely damage a website’s reputation and erode user trust. Visitors are more likely to interact with and trust websites that prioritize their security.
SEO Benefits: Search engines like Google prioritize secure websites. Having proper security measures in place can positively impact your search engine rankings.
Preventing Business Disruption: A successful cyberattack can disrupt website operations, leading to downtime and potential financial losses. Strong security measures minimize this risk.
Compliance with Regulations: Depending on the industry and location, websites may be legally required to implement specific security measures to protect user data.

SSL Certificates: The Foundation of Website Security

SSL (Secure Sockets Layer) certificates are the bedrock of website security. They encrypt the communication between a user’s browser and the website server, preventing sensitive information from being intercepted by malicious actors.

How SSL Certificates Work

An SSL certificate creates a secure connection by using cryptography. When a user visits a website with an SSL certificate:

1. The browser requests the website’s SSL certificate.
2. The server sends the certificate, which contains the website’s public key.
3. The browser verifies the certificate’s authenticity with a trusted Certificate Authority (CA).
4. If the certificate is valid, the browser and server establish an encrypted connection.

Types of SSL Certificates

Several types of SSL certificates cater to different needs:

Single Domain SSL: Secures one specific domain.
Wildcard SSL: Secures a primary domain and all its subdomains.
Multi-Domain SSL: Secures multiple different domains under a single certificate.
Extended Validation (EV) SSL: Provides the highest level of assurance and displays the organization’s name in the browser’s address bar.

Hosting Protection: Safeguarding Your Server

While SSL certificates protect data in transit, robust hosting protection safeguards your website at the server level. Choosing a secure hosting provider and implementing appropriate security measures is crucial.

Choosing a Secure Hosting Provider

When selecting a hosting provider, consider the following security features:

Firewalls: Protect against unauthorized access to the server.
Malware Scanning & Removal: Regularly scans for and removes malicious software.
Intrusion Detection & Prevention Systems (IDPS): Monitors server activity for suspicious behavior and automatically takes action to prevent attacks.
DDoS Protection: Mitigates Distributed Denial of Service (DDoS) attacks that can overwhelm a server and bring down a website.
Regular Backups: Ensures data can be restored in case of a security breach or server failure.

Implementing Essential Hosting Security Measures

Beyond choosing a secure host, implement these measures:

Strong Passwords & Two-Factor Authentication: Use complex passwords and enable two-factor authentication for all server access.
Regular Software Updates: Keep all server software, including the operating system, web server, and database, up-to-date to patch security vulnerabilities.
Security Audits: Conduct regular security audits to identify and address potential weaknesses.
Web Application Firewalls (WAFs): Filter malicious traffic specifically targeting web applications.
